Chapter 14

- Mia White -

I couldn't wait until school was over. Ace wouldn't tell me where he was taking me, saying it was a surprise.

Of course I had to tell Sarah, and when I told her, she was practically screaming that she was right about him having feelings for me.

She even said that she was going over to my house to help me get ready.

On the other hand, Mindy looked furious. Someone must've heard our conversation, and told everyone about it.

During class, I could feel Mindy's eyes burning the back of my head.

Ace wasn't even here today. Not even Levi or Ben. I texted and called each of them, but they didn't answer. Seriously, what's with these guys always ignoring me?

Lunch came around, and the next thing I knew was being pushed into an empty classroom by one of Mindy's minions.

Mindy angrily walked towards me before slapping me hard on the cheek. It hurt more since I also felt her nails scratch my cheek. Her nails were freakishly long. I consider them claws.

"Stay the fuck away from Ace," she hissed. "You already know that we're engaged. Stop messing it up for us."

"He didn't want to marry you in the first place."

Another slap in the face.

"It doesn't matter. He'll learn how to love me." I inwardly scoffed at that. I know how much Ace hates Mindy as much as I hate her.

"Now, I want you to cancel your little date, and stay out of his life for good."

"Yeah, sorry to burst your bubble but I can't do that," she was about to slap me again but this time, I caught her wrist. She was going to use her other hand, but I pushed her away before she had a chance to.

Mindy stumbled back, almost falling but composed herself.

She opened her mouth to say something when I cut her off.

"Please, save your breath. You'll probably need it to blow up your next date."

Mindy gritted her teeth, but didn't do anything.

Before any more violence could be done, I walked out of the room after her friends moved out of the way.

I can't believe I just said that!

I feel a bit guilty for saying something that was mean - but probably true - but she crossed the line when she slapped me. Mindy has never physically hurt me. She's only verbally bullied me since I first met her.

"Are you okay?"

I was snapped out of my thoughts, and saw Max standing there.

"Max? What are you doing here?"

He chuckled. "Sarah forgot her lunch," he replied, holing it out for me. "It's good to see you again."

"Likewise," I said with a smile. He handed me Sarah's lunch so I could give it to her, before walking away.

I found Sarah in the cafeteria with a few of her other friends. When I handed her lunch to her, she gave me a confused look. I told her that Max came to school, saying that she forgot her lunch, but her expression didn't change.

"I told Max that I didn't need lunch. You know I always buy mine at the canteen."

Then why did Max say she forgot her lunch

Well, it didn't really matter anyways since Sarah still ate whatever was in the bag.

Sarah then saw the slap marks on my cheeks, and I told her how I got them before she asked.

When I mentioned Mindy's name, Sarah was ready to murder her. I told her not to do anything, but she was stubborn. Eventually, I got her to listen to me, and now we're in the bathroom with her applying concealer so it wouldn't show as much.

"Next time she even thinks about hurting you, I'll kill her," Sarah threatened. "I'll hit her with a pan, drag her onto the road, run her over, hang her by the tree of my backyard and—"

"Okay!" I cut her off. "I don't want to know what you'll do next."

Sarah can be very scary sometimes.

"Seriously though. If she gives you any more trouble, just give me a call," she ordered.

"And I know she will. You told me about their arranged marriage, and Ace asking you out. You're in for one hell of a ride."

"Gee, thanks."

"Anytime."

x-X-x

Sarah accompanied me back home, and the moment we walked in, she was already rushing to my room, and messing up my closet.

"Because he didn't tell you where you guys were going," Sarah stated, eyeing a shirt before throwing it away.

"You'll have to wear something comfy but made it look like you actually tried."

I laughed, but she just gave me a serious look.

After trying out at least seven or more outfits, we both decided on a simple look. She had found dark, ripped skinny jeans that I had no idea I owned, a loose white shirt, with a gray cardigan.

I looked in the mirror as Sarah stood beside me with a wide smile, accomplished with her work.

"Perfect."

"Thanks for helping me out," I said.

I don't think I could be ready if Sarah wasn't here with me. To be honest, I was nervous. It's weird because I've known Ace for my whole life, but this was different.

We're no longer just best friends.

"Alright!" Sarah exclaimed, breaking me out of my train of thoughts. "We still have a few hours to spare, so let's watch a movie to kill time."

Sarah flipped through the movies on Netflix while I was in the kitchen baking cookings for her as a thank you for helping me out.

Sarah told me that there was nothing to worry about because I was going to be with Ace, and well, we both know that he wouldn't let a fly hurt me. She said that I shouldn't even be nervous because Ace and I were already dating before he officially asked me out.

I blushed at that. How did I not realize that people thought we were dating before he even asked me out? And when did he develop feelings for me? Surely I would've noticed.

Or maybe not because I'm pretty clueless when romance is actually happening in my life, and not in the books I read.

When the cookies were finished, I put them all on a plate, and grabbed a glass of milk before going to the living room. Sarah's head snapped towards me, and her eyes sparkled when she saw what I was placing on the table.

"Oh my God, I love you," she said, already devouring them.

I laughed, and just as I sobered up, the bell rang. Sarah and I looked at the door, knowing that it was Ace waiting for me.

"Alright kiddo, show time," she said, getting up from the couch, and dragging me to the door. She let me slip into my white converse, before she gave me one last check to see that everything was okay.

"Ace is gonna fall in love with you even more," she smiled, making me blush.

Sarah wished me good luck as she walked back to the couch, finally picking a movie.

I looked at the door, my heart racing as I gripped the handle, and opened the door.
